Abstract

The invention relates to a range extender control method and device, a vehicle, a storage medium and electronic device.Under the condition that a power battery of the vehicle meets a first preset starting condition, whether the vehicle is in a high-speed working condition or not is determined, and the first preset starting condition is a preset condition for starting a range extender of the vehicle; when the vehicle is in the high-speed working condition, a range extender of the vehicle is started, and the range extender is kept in the starting state; determining whether the vehicle exits the high-speed working condition; and under the condition that the vehicle exits the high-speed working condition, if the vehicle meets a first preset closing condition, the range extender is closed, and the first preset closing condition is a preset condition for closing the range extender when the vehicle exits the high-speed working condition. Therefore, under the high-speed working condition, the energy loss of the vehicle can be greatly reduced, meanwhile, the charge-discharge cycle times of the power battery can be reduced, and the service life of the power battery is prolonged.

technical field [0001] The present disclosure relates to the field of vehicle control, and in particular, to a range extender control method, device, vehicle, storage medium and electronic device. Background technique [0002] The short cruising range of new energy vehicles has always been the most concerned issue. Although the electric power and energy density of pure electric vehicles have increased year by year, the amount of electric power has always been limited due to the influence of the layout space of the whole vehicle. As a new model, the extended-range electric vehicle can charge the vehicle's power battery through the range extender, thereby solving the problem of short cruising range. However, due to the existence of the range extender, there will be unnecessary energy loss in the use of the extended range electric vehicle, resulting in high energy consumption of the vehicle.
